WebMar 21, 2024 · Considering that 30% of malignant PEs were not detected by cytology, we assessed how powerful the TMs were in identifying these cases. The results showed that among single markers, CEA was the best one, detecting 60% of cytologically negative malignant PEs, followed by CA-19-9 with a sensitivity of 54% in this population.

WebAmong the malignant lymphomas of the diffuse, poorly differentiated lymphocytic type, a cytologically distinctive form can be recognized. It is composed of immature lymphoid cells that are indistinguishable from the cells of acute lymphoblastic leukemia (ALL).
